    Quote Originally Posted by T90jlm View Post
    I am in the same position. My ITA needs to be submitted by start of April and I am wondering how this will affect my application, obviously I will submit the email I got from NZQA stating that I have submitted my qualifications to them for assessing but I am unsure if this will be ok.
    It will be ok. I did the same. I lodged my IQA application in November and lodged my ITA in late January including the email from NZQA (in the email it says that you can include it in your application). And yesterday my IQA got finalised and I should receive it really soon. All in all, it took around 3.5 months to get my IQA.
